It is cold outside. The wind that crackles through the Norwegian night pulls the temperature down to -20°c, a temperature that seems all the more chill when stepping from the warm confines of the tents and in to its biting teeth. Inside the main tent, a open brasier heats the ‘room’, the heavy smell of woodsmoke combines with the occasional acrid wiff of burnt rubber as someone leaves their boots too close for too long in an attempt to warm their toes. In the smaller tents, tiny woodburners do their best to stave off the chill. Inevitably at some point in the night their fire turns to embers and then cools, allowing the last vestiges of heat to be sucked away. We awoke in the morning more than once to the crackle of ice on the ouside of our sleeping bags.
Tentipi Nordic tipis are based upon the traditional design principles of the Sami kåta, coupled with innovative new design, and the latest materials and construction techniques.
